Maintenance Tips of MG 10038150 Screw for MG6
- When working on the MG6, always use the correct size of the MG screw (OE# 10038150). Using an improper size can lead to stripped threads.
- Before installing the screw, make sure the hole is clean and free of debris. This ensures a tight fit and prevents damage to the screw.
- Apply a small amount of thread locker to the MG screw threads. This helps to prevent the screw from loosening due to vibrations during driving.
- Tighten the screw to the specified torque. Over - tightening can break the screw, while under - tightening may cause components to come loose.
- Regularly inspect the MG screws on your MG6. Loose or damaged screws should be replaced immediately to maintain vehicle safety.
Caution: Do not overtighten the MG screw (OE# 10038150) as it can cause the material around the hole to crack, leading to potential structural damage.
